Teaching procedures and ways教学过程与方式
Step I Revision and and Lead-in
Check the students’ homework and ask them to spell some new words and make a dialogue about their likes and dislikes.
T: Li Ping. What’s your favourite food?
S: Hamburgers.
T: Well, can you spell the word for us?
S: H-a-m-b-u-r-g-e-r-s.
T: Good. Do you like French fries?
S: No, I don’t. But I like ice cream very much.
Write “hamburger”, “French fries” and “ice cream” on the blackboard.
T: Thank you. Next, I’d like some pairs to practice your conversations in front of the class, any volunteers? I’ll give the best pair a prize as a reward.
Sample conversation 1:
S1: Do you like strawberries?
S2: Yes, I do.
Sample conversation 2:
S1: Do you like bananas?
S2: No, I don’t but I like tomatoes
Step II Listening (2a, 2b)
Ask the students to read the words in the box and talk about the pictures first, then listen to the recording and finish activities 2a and 2b.
T: We can see many English names for food in the box of activity 2a. Do you know them? Can you understand the meaning of each of them?
Invite one student to practice reading and tell the meanings of the words. And then ask students to read after the teacher and finally ask them to practice reading by themselves.
T: Next we’ll listen to three conversations. In the conversation, a boy and a girl are talking about their likes and dislikes about food. For the first time, please don’t look at your book. Just listen carefully.
Play the tape for the first time. Ask the students to listen to the recording again and try to finish the sentences in the picture.
T: We can see some pictures and some sentences in 2b. In the first picture we can see some hamburgers. Do you know the food in picture 2 and 3?
Get the students to talk about the last two pictures and choose the names for the food from 2a. Then ask them to listen to the tape again and try to finish the sentences in the pictures.
Play the recording again, check the answers. And then ask students to listen again and repeat after the recording.
Step III Pair work (2c)
Ask students to work in pairs to practice the above conversations and give answers that are true to themselves.

Step IV Role-play
Ask the students to read this part by themselves first, and then , put them into groups of 3, act out the dialogue.
Step V Homework
Ask the students to recite 2d.
Ask the students to practice talking about the food they like and dislike using different persons and nouns.
